Transaction dcf64f4c21c79f8e3a9136a5a0760f909683e0607dd98ab49f7254fb9953e354
1 Input
1 Output
-
dcf64f4c21c79f8e3a9136a5a0760f909683e0607dd98ab49f7254fb9953e354:0
- value
- 870221
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0ad608825326408a2de5c85f20c4b31668fac056 OP_EQUAL
- address
- 32gK5kacP4mnULqJFq9X2e1Wvms3kj4YcT